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02198 47314204 12078
872921876 15441063
872921876 15441063
4154292 18685696350 87215018
All about undefined
Interested in learning more?
872921876 15441063
4154292 18685696350 87215018
See more
297431548 632052 252
6560067 8663 364 87
See more
071167 657493921
811758 392 6315 652663 43497284666
See more